Travale Climbs Leaderboard in Day Two at NCAA Regional

TALLAHASSEE, Fla. – UCF men's golfer Johnny Travale continued to build on his strong start at the NCAA Tallahassee regional on Tuesday, posting a 70(-2) second round to bring his two-day total to 139(-5), tying him for ninth place out of 75 golfers.

Currently leading the field, Jacksonville University's Michael Sakane, also playing as an individual in the tournament, holds a 133(-11) score.

Travale opened up play on the front nine on Tuesday one under par after birdying two holes and bogeying one. He repeated on the back nine, again birdying twice and bogeying the par four hole 12 to bring his 18-hole total to 70(-2).

Travale has excelled on par fives over the first two rounds, shooting six under on those holes.

Host school Florida State currently leads all teams with a 552(-24) total. To advance to the NCAA Championship in Scottsdale, Arizona, Travale must post the lowest individual score of any golfer not on a team that finishes in the top five.

Travale will be back at it Wednesday morning for the final round. He is set to tee off on hole one at 10:23 a.m.
